Here are some photos of the maiden voyage yesterday in LA. The following comments are from Kmot, the gent who started the Hansen Dam Irregulars:
"Cap'n Steve Neill maidened a new submarine today and it is quite special. It is the Nautilus from Jules Vernes' "20 Thousand Leagues Under the Sea" and it was constructed true to the book and Jules Verne and not the fantasized Disney version.
It is quite large, over 4 feet I would guess. And it looks amazing in its copper cladding. The sub functioned superb all throughout its initial running, except for one minor glitch when the hatch came undone. Which in turn knocked the rudder loose. A little hatch tape and it soon was back in the water diving, sailing under water, etc. It's a very awesome sub and I like it best of all the subs I have seen out there. And it sure was easy to film compared to those black painted ones!"
